| """File System Proxy.
 | |
| 
 | |
| Provide an OS-neutral view on a file system, locally or remotely.
 | |
| The functionality is geared towards implementing some sort of
 | |
| rdist-like utility between a Mac and a UNIX system.
 | |
| 
 | |
| The module defines three classes:
 | |
| 
 | |
| FSProxyLocal  -- used for local access
 | |
| FSProxyServer -- used on the server side of remote access
 | |
| FSProxyClient -- used on the client side of remote access
 | |
| 
 | |
| The remote classes are instantiated with an IP address and an optional
 | |
| verbosity flag.
 | |
| """
